Mac Davis was an American musician born on January 21, 1942. He was a talented singer-songwriter known for his contributions to country and pop music. Davis gained fame in the 1970s with hits like "Baby, Don't Get Hooked on Me" and "I Believe in Music." He also wrote songs for other artists and appeared in television shows and films. Mac Davis's charisma and musical talent made him a beloved figure in the entertainment industry. He passed away on September 29, 2020, leaving behind a rich legacy of music.
